Magic Bus: The Who on Tour was the fourth American album by British rock band The Who, released in the US in September 1968 to capitalize on the success of their single of the same name.[1] It is a compilation album of previously released material, and was not issued in the UK, although the album was also released at approximately the same time in Canada. It peaked at #39 on the Billboard 200.[2]

The somewhat deceptive title implies that the songs were recorded live, but all recordings here are in fact studio tracks. The album's track list duplicates a few songs from the second and third US albums, but also contains singles tracks and tracks from extended play singles that were previously unavailable on a US album. Members of the group and Pete Townshend in particular have frequently expressed their dislike of this compilation. When the cover pictures were taken the group was not made aware by Decca that the shots would be used for a US album. Immediately following the modest success of this album, a similar but unrelated Who compilation, Direct Hits, was released in the UK by Track Records.

In 1974, the album was re-issued by MCA Records in the US and Canada as part of a budget priced double album set which also included the 1966 US debut The Who Sings My Generation. It was reissued on compact disc by MCA Records in the 1980s, but was not included among the catalogue remastering that took place in the 1990s. Though out of print in the US, the 1980s CD remains available in Canada.

Track listing

All songs written by Pete Townshend except where noted.

Side one

  1. "Disguises" – 3:14 (from the UK EP Ready Steady Who, 1966)
  2. "Run Run Run"– 2:44 (from Happy Jack, 1966)
  3. "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de" (John Entwistle) – 2:27 (single b-side, 1968)
  4. "I Can't Reach You" – 3:05 (from The Who Sell Out, 1967)
  5. "Our Love Was, Is" – 3:09 (from The Who Sell Out, 1967)
  6. "Call Me Lightning" – 2:25 (US single A-side, 1968)

Side two

  1. "Magic Bus" – 3:21 (single A-side, 1968)
  2. "Someone's Coming" (Entwistle) – 2:33 (single b-side, 1968)
  3. "Doctor, Doctor" (Entwistle) – 3:02 (single b-side, 1967)
  4. "Bucket T" (Don Altfeld, Roger Christian, Dean Torrence) – 2:11 (from Ready, Steady, Who, 1966)
  5. "Pictures of Lily" – 2:43 (single A-side, 1967)
